Description

The module has both taught and research elements. Taught element: In the taught element different types of composites and their manufacturing processes are introduced. It involves prediction of the bulk properties of the fibre reinforced composites using the properties of its constituents and simplified micro models. Micro-mechanical models are introduced for the prediction of stiffness and failure properties of individual unidirectional plies. Classical laminate theory is then used to evaluate the stiffness and strength of laminates with different lay-ups of constituent plies. Assignment Element: An individual assignment will be set to allow students to research and produce an innovative design for a composite material component. The material and process conditions must be carefully researched and the most appropriate selected and described in detail. The use of the predictive models described covered in the lectures will be required in order to predict the properties of the component which is designed. The main objective of the assignment is for the students to learn to obtain information and to apply it to solve a practical problem. It also reduces the contribution of a single exam on the assessment and provides a different method of assessing the capabilities of the students on a broader basis. The assignment is an individual effort.
